The Hits Album plus an issue number released was through to June 1989 and stopped at Hits 10, although the ninth volume had previously been released in December 1988 without an issue number. Subsequent releases through to 1991 were released without an issue number and this successive refreshing of the Hits brand could be seen as minor relaunches of the series, each time in the face of the continuing success and strength of the rival Now! brand. From November 1989, the albums in the Hits series started deviating from their original chronological number system and began using alternative titles. From November 1989 to July 1991, The Hits Albums were released with these titles: Monster Hits (November 1989).
